1st logo (1990)
Logo: On a black night star field background, we see a big yellow "W" zoom in. Behind the W is a teddy bear wearing pajamas. Then, the words "WONDERLAND VIDEO" in white fade in underneath.
Technique: The "W" and a teddy bear zooming in.
Music/Sounds: A pretty synthesized percussion/woodwind tune.
Availability: Can be found on videos of At the Zoo with Johnny Morris.
2nd logo (Early 1990s)
Logo: On a blue night star field background, we see a big red/golden yellow gradient "W" zoom in. Behind the W is a teddy bear wearing pajamas. Then, the words "Wonderland Video" in white fade in underneath.
Technique: Same as before.
Music/Sounds: A remix of the first music, which would be sometimes high-pitched.
Availability: Can be found on videos of Bonjour les Amis!, co-distributed by Monterey Home Video.
